Sugoroku's friend (Toei) |
Sugoroku's friend is an unnamed character in the Toei Yu-Gi-Oh! anime, based on Sugoroku's friend, from the manga.
Biography[edit]
Sugoroku Mutou's friend is a gamer from America. He gave his "Blue-Eyes White Dragon" card to Sugoroku. Sugoroku kept a photo of him in the game shop and held the card with high sentimental value, refusing to sell it to Seto Kaiba.[1]
